Ottawa declares July 11th as Srebrenica Genocide Remembrance Day

On the occasion of the 30th anniversary of the Srebrenica genocide, the mayor of the Canadian capital, Ottawa, declared July 11, 2025, the Day of Remembrance for the Victims of the Srebrenica Genocide.

The Genocide Research Institute of Canada announced that, in remembering the Srebrenica genocide, we commit to always defending the truth, justice, the culture of remembrance and the human dignity of the victims both in Bosnia and Herzegovina and in the world.

They added that they will continuously strengthen the culture of remembrance and institutionally fight against the denial of genocide, the denial of judicial and historical facts and the glorification of convicted war criminals.

“We call on the Ambassador of Bosnia and Herzegovina to Canada to understand this proclamation by the mayor of the capital, Ottawa, as a need to respect the decisions of the Parliament of Canada on the genocide in Srebrenica, and the decisions of the competent authorities of Bosnia and Herzegovina, and to lower the flag of Bosnia and Herzegovina on the embassy building on July 11,” the Institute announced.
